Fossil PDA Watch First Thoughts

Well, I recieved my Fossil PDA Watch on Friday night. Most of the online reviews I read were positive, but when I asked on Aximsite, I didn't get very good feedback. After reading reviews, I was expecting it to be big, but I was still a little shocked at the size of the watch! It looks about the size of a little match box on your wrist. This is definatly not for women, and really only for men with bigger arms and wrists to wear it on.

That said, I am still really liking the watch. The curve of the band really helps to reduce the appearance of it on your wrist, and the rubber wrist bands help add to the comfort. Setting up the software and syncing is a breeze, and after a little playing around, I have figured out how to navigate through the option fairly well. It can sync your contacts, notes, tasks, and calander.

I would NEVER have paid the suggested retail price of $150 for this, but for the $20 I got it off ebay, I am loving it. I would recommend it if you can get this cheap price, and don't mind a huge watch.
